Break-Glass: Orders Soft Deletes (Marrowgate Wiki)

For the eng sync: reminder that rows in `orders` are soft-deleted only — `is_deleted` flag, nothing physical. Break-glass restores go through the Hollis console, which is locked outside business hours. If you genuinely need emergency access, the console accepts a standing recovery passphrase instead of the usual approval chain. The current passphrase is recorded below.

strongbox words: belox-holix-gilael-julmir-druox-olieth-raleth-noviel-belius-wenox-holix-holox-oliys-ruswyn

## Digest scheduler release — Quicknest

Heads up: the batch email digest cron moved from hourly to a 15-min cadence this release. If digests pile up, bump `digest.batch_size` in the Quicknest console before touching the queue — draining it manually double-sends, and Marisol will not be thrilled. Deploy goes through the usual `shipit digest-svc` flow. The artifact must be signed before the scheduler picks it up, so use the release key below.

signing key of bagap-yawep = bky13_TbfT6ZMUoGJo2

Runbook: ScanBridge barcode intake. Reviewer notes: the scanner daemon on the Kestrelware kiosks posts decoded EAN payloads to the intake queue; dedupe runs before the write path. If the queue drains but rows don't land, restart the intake worker, not the daemon. Check that the symbology allowlist matches the Lenholt warehouse profile. All writes go through the scan_events table with a 30s statement timeout. Verify connectivity using the primary intake database connection string below.

primary connection of yagep-kahip = redis://giliel_svc:zYiKsLL2PLpfPL@db-348f.xolmarsys.corp:5432/fenwyn